Fatal Crashes


James987
 Share

Recommended Posts

GTA Vice City invariably crashes EACH time I play, usually after 20-30 minutes but sometimes only after 5. It always happens when I'm in a car. The game freezes but the mp3 (I only use the default Vice City radio station) keeps playing. I can't return to Windows or end the game so I have to turn off my pc.

I have tried EVERYTHING on this forum but so far nothing has worked. The crashes occur no matter what resolution I'm in. The only solution I can't try is update my graphics driver because my XP for some reason won't let me do it - it messes up any kind of driver uninstallation/installation I do.

 

Pentium 4 3.0 GH

1 G RAM

ATI Radeon 256 Meg Hypermemory ---> impossible to update driver

XP pro SP 2

Doesn't work? Try the opposite - see if you can roll back a driver (to one that worked). It should be able to update though. Perhaps roll back and then try to update. And run a virus/spyware scan too, because as far as I'm concerned, something doesn't add up with that.

 

Toggle frame limiter, and just reinstall the game. You never know, reinstalls are magic. wow.gif

You never know, reinstalls are magic. wow.gif

Only if accompanied by a SET file deletion wink.gif Which should actually be the first thing tried. Keep in mind that many pirated versions of VC has volatile audio errors such as this.

Link to comment
Share on other sites

Thanks for advice... reinstalling Vice City doesn't get rid of the crashes so it seems likely that my current catalyst driver for my radeon video card is the culprit. It's the original driver that came with this PC when I bought it last November and, and although a spanking new PC, the catalyst control center crashes upon loading. I've tried loads of different drivers and versions, ATI's own drivers, the alternate Omega ones, I used DriverClean as well, but no matter what I do, XP seems to hate me fiddling with video drivers. I also run Spybot, Adaware and AVG on a regular basis so I doubt spyware/viruses are the problem. It's most frustrating as other games run fine. I also found out on the GTA developers' own support site that Service Pack 2 is not supported. Could that be the problem?

PC is still under guarantee so I'll get tech support to sort out my video driver, unless someones knows better?

 

Pentium 4 3.0 Gh HT

1 G RAM

ATI Radeon 256 MB PCIe Hypermemory

XP Pro SP2

I also found out on the GTA developers' own support site that Service Pack 2 is not supported. Could that be the problem?

No. Vice City works flawlessly on my PC - with Service Pack 2.

 

Tech support sounds like a good idea.
